Mexico out of 2022 World Cup on goal difference tiebreaker; Argentina, Poland advance from Group C

Now that Groups A and B have been decided, it’s the turn of Groups C and D to decide who will advance to Wednesday’s World Cup knockout round. For Mexico, their 2-1 win over Saudi Arabia was not enough to overcome their goal difference against Poland. Lionel Messi and Argentina beat Robert Lewandowski’s Poland 2-0, meaning Argentina won Group C and Poland finished second for most of the game A fair play decider appeared to be the deciding factor, with Mexico and Poland level on points, goal difference and goals, but a late goal from Saudi Arabia sealed the deal, leaving Mexico behind Poland. Mexico failed to reach the knockout rounds for the first time since 1978. Poland advanced to the round of 16 with a better goal difference.

Earlier, in Group D, Tunisia beat France 1-0 and Australia beat Denmark 1-0. France, despite losing the game, will advance after winning the group stage, while Australia managed to win and will advance to the last 16 of the World Cup for the first time since 2006 and only the second time in their history. Denmark ended up bottom of the group after a very disappointing game.
